版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
分布式学习系统软件建模方法研究随着和云计算技术的快速发展,分布式学习系统越来越受到人们的。分布式学习系统是一种基于分布式计算技术的学习管理系统,它能够在多个计算节点上并行处理数据,提高学习效率。然而,分布式学习系统的开发和应用仍面临许多挑战,其中之一就是如何对其进行有效的软件建模。本文旨在探讨分布式学习系统软件建模方法的研究现状、存在问题及其解决方案。
分布式学习系统软件建模方法的研究具有重要的意义。通过对分布式学习系统的软件建模,可以有效地推动软件产业的发展,提高软件的质量和可靠性。软件建模方法的改进可以帮助开发人员降低开发成本,提高开发效率,加速软件的上市时间。合理有效的软件建模方法还可以帮助企业更好地理解和优化分布式学习系统的性能,提高系统的效率和稳定性。
目前,分布式学习系统软件建模方法的研究还存在一些问题和不足。现有的软件建模方法往往过于复杂,难以理解和实施。很多方法缺乏通用性,无法适应不同的分布式学习系统场景。一些方法没有充分考虑到分布式学习系统的特性,如并行性、分布式等,导致其无法充分发挥分布式学习系统的优势。
为了解决上述问题,我们将采用以下研究方法:我们将对现有的分布式学习系统软件建模方法进行深入的文献调研,了解其优缺点和使用场景。我们将对这些方法进行理论分析,探究其数学原理和实现机制。再次,我们将通过案例研究的方式,分析这些方法在实际项目中的应用效果。我们将利用数据分析的手段,对这些方法进行性能评估和对比。
通过以上的研究方法,我们取得了一系列的研究成果。我们提出了一种创新的分布式学习系统软件建模方法,该方法具有简单、易理解和通用性强的优点。我们设计了一种新型的分布式学习模型,该模型能够更好地利用分布式计算的优势,提高学习效率。我们开发了一种高效的分布式学习算法,该算法能够自动调整学习参数,优化系统性能。
在实践应用中,我们发现这些创新方法、模型和工具能够有效地提高分布式学习系统的性能和稳定性,并且可以帮助开发人员快速构建高效的分布式学习系统。
本文对分布式学习系统软件建模方法进行了深入的研究,提出了一种创新的分布式学习系统软件建模方法及其相应的模型和工具。通过理论分析和实践应用,我们发现这些方法、模型和工具能够有效地提高分布式学习系统的性能和稳定性,并且可以帮助开发人员快速构建高效的分布式学习系统。然而,本研究仍存在一些问题和不足之处,例如如何进一步提高分布式学习系统软件建模方法的效率和实用性,以及如何更好地利用分布式计算技术优化学习算法等方面还需要进一步的研究和探索。
随着计算机技术的不断发展,分布式系统越来越成为主流应用模式。分布式系统软件体系结构作为分布式系统的核心,对其建模与开发方法进行研究具有重要意义。本文将介绍分布式系统软件体系结构的背景和意义、建模过程以及开发方法,最后探讨应用实践和未来研究方向。
分布式系统软件体系结构是指将一组独立的计算机节点通过网络相互连接,共同完成特定的任务或提供服务。这种体系结构使得系统具有更高的可扩展性、可靠性和性能,同时降低了单点故障的风险。然而,分布式系统软件体系结构也面临着一系列的挑战和需求,如通信开销、容错处理、负载均衡等。
分布式系统软件体系结构的建模过程包括需求分析、系统设计、数据模型设计等环节。
需求分析是建模的第一步,主要是对系统的功能和非功能需求进行详细描述。在需求分析过程中,需要明确系统的参与者、功能模块以及它们之间的交互关系。
系统设计是根据需求分析的结果,设计出符合实际应用场景的分布式系统软件体系结构。这一过程需要考虑节点组织、通信机制、任务分配等因素,并通过对多种设计方案进行评估和比较,选择最优方案。
数据模型设计是建模过程中的重要环节,主要是定义系统中数据的结构、属性、约束和关系。在分布式系统中,数据模型设计需要考虑数据的一致性、完整性、安全性和可恢复性等方面的问题。
分布式系统软件体系结构的开发方法包括过程建模和实现两个阶段。
在过程建模阶段,主要是通过对开发过程进行抽象和描述,形成一套适用于分布式系统软件体系结构开发的流程和方法。常用的过程建模方法包括敏捷开发、迭代开发等,这些方法注重需求分析、设计评审以及测试验收等环节,以确保开发过程的质量和效率。
在实现阶段,需要按照过程模型中规定的方法和步骤进行代码编写、调试和测试等工作。由于分布式系统的复杂性,开发过程中需要注意以下几个问题:
通信机制:分布式系统中的节点需要通过网络进行通信,因此需要选择合适的通信协议和数据交换格式,以保证系统中的信息能够高效、可靠地传输。
容错处理:由于分布式系统中存在多个节点,因此需要考虑如何处理节点故障的情况。常用的容错技术包括备份、恢复、重试等,可以根据实际需求进行选择和组合。
负载均衡:为了充分发挥分布式系统的性能,需要将任务合理地分配给各个节点,以实现负载的均衡分布。负载均衡策略可以根据实际情况进行调整,如根据节点的性能、负载情况等因素进行分配。
系统集成:分布式系统软件体系结构涉及多个节点和组件,因此需要进行系统集成,以保证各个组件能够协同工作并实现整体功能。集成过程中需要注意接口规范、数据共享等问题。
为了检验分布式系统软件体系结构建模与开发方法的有效性,需要进行评估和改进实践。评估可以从时间、成本和质量三个方面进行全面衡量。时间评估主要是对比使用该方法与传统方法所需的时间;成本评估主要包括开发过程中的人工成本、物资消耗等;质量评估则需要对系统的功能、性能、稳定性等方面进行评价。
根据评估结果,可以发现该方法的优点和不足之处,从而针对不足之处进行改进或扩展。例如,可以优化通信机制以减少通信开销,加强容错处理以提高系统的可靠性,采用更高效的负载均衡策略以充分发挥分布式系统的性能等。
本文对分布式系统软件体系结构的建模与开发方法进行了研究。通过需求分析、系统设计、数据模型设计等环节完成建模过程,并从过程建模和实现角度探讨了开发方法。通过评估实践,证明了所提出的方法在时间、成本和质量方面均具有优势。然而,仍有一些不足之处需要进一步改进或扩展,如优化通信机制、加强容错处理等。
未来研究方向包括:深入挖掘分布式系统软件体系结构的内在规律,研究更加高效的需求分析、系统设计和数据模型设计方法;结合、机器学习等技术,探索更加智能化的开发方法;针对分布式系统的特定应用场景,研究具有针对性的建模与开发策略;加强实践应用与案例分析,将研究成果应用于实际工程项目中,以推动分布式系统软件体系结构的发展与应用。
随着计算机技术的快速发展,分布式文件系统已成为共享访问、持久化存储和共享访问的重要工具。然而,随着其规模的不断扩大和使用场景的多样化,如何确保分布式文件系统的性能成为了一个亟待解决的问题。本文将介绍分布式文件系统性能建模及应用研究的重要性,阐述相关的研究方法、应用场景、案例分析以及结论和建议。
分布式文件系统是将文件数据存储在多个不同的节点上,以便增强可靠性和可用性。与传统的单一存储系统相比,分布式文件系统具有更高的性能和可扩展性。然而,随着节点数量和数据量的不断增加,分布式文件系统的性能会受到不同程度的影响。为了更好地管理和优化分布式文件系统的性能,性能建模及应用研究显得尤为重要。
性能建模是指通过建立数学模型来描述系统的性能表现。在分布式文件系统中,性能建模需要考虑多个因素,如节点数量、网络带宽、数据访问频率等。通过对这些因素进行分析和处理,可以得出系统在不同条件下的性能表现。一般来说,性能建模包括以下步骤:
确定性能指标:根据实际需求,确定需要考察的性能指标,如响应时间、吞吐量、并发量等。
建立模型:根据已知的性能指标,建立相应的数学模型,如排队模型、网络模型等。
数据采集与分析:通过实际测试和采集数据,验证模型的正确性,并根据实际需求对模型进行优化和调整。
在分布式文件系统中,性能建模的应用场景非常广泛。例如,在设计阶段,性能建模可以帮助开发人员预测系统的性能表现,从而更好地进行系统规划和设计。在运行阶段,性能建模可以实时监控系统的运行状态,及时发现并解决潜在的性能问题。性能建模还可以为系统的优化和升级提供重要的参考依据。
接下来,我们以一个具体的案例进行分析。假设一个大型互联网企业需要建立一个分布式文件系统来存储大量的用户数据,以便提高可靠性和访问效率。在建立性能模型时,我们需要考虑以下步骤:
确定性能指标:考虑到该企业对于数据存储和访问的速度有较高的要求,我们选择响应时间和吞吐量作为主要的性能指标。
建立模型:根据所搜集的资料和该企业的实际需求,我们决定采用排队模型来建立性能模型。
排队模型是一种经典的性能模型,它通过分析服务器的请求队列来评估系统的性能表现。在本案例中,我们将请求队列视为一个M/M/c模型(即到达间隔时间和服务时间都符合指数分布,服务器有c个处理单元)。
数据采集与分析:通过在实际系统中进行测试和数据采集,我们获得了响应时间和吞吐量等实际数据。通过对这些数据进行分析,我们发现排队模型能够较为准确地预测系统的性能表现。
在此基础上,我们根据实际数据对模型进行优化和调整,最终得出了一个更加精确的性能模型。该模型能够实时监控系统的性能表现,并在出现性能问题时及时发出预警。该模型还能够为系统的优化和升级提供重要的参考依据。
分布式文件系统性能建模及应用研究是确保分布式文件系统性能的关键手段。在实际应用中,我们需要综合运用多种方法和技术手段来建立合适的性能模型,并根据应用场景和实际情况对模型进行优化和调整。我们还需要密切相关领域的研究动态和技术发展趋势,以便及时引入新的技术和方法来提高分布式文件系统的性能和可靠性。
随着软件产业的快速发展,软件产品线变得越来越复杂,这就需要软件企业不断优化软件产品线,提高软件产品的质量和生产效率。软件产品线可变性建模技术成为解决这一问题的关键所在。本文将对软件产品线可变性建模技术进行综述,旨在梳理和总结该领域的研究现状和发展趋势。
关键词:软件产品线、可变性建模、模型管理、模型推理、可变模型
软件产品线是指一系列具有相似需求、功能或特征的软件产品。随着市场竞争的加剧,软件企业需要不断推出新的软件产品来满足客户需求,同时还要保证软件产品的质量和生产效率。软件产品线可变性建模技术是一种针对软件产品线进行建模的方法和技术,通过对软件产品线的特征进行分析、抽象和建模,实现对软件产品线的有效管理和优化。
软件产品线可变性建模技术包括多个方面,其中最重要的是模型管理和模型推理。模型管理主要负责建立、维护和版本控制模型,保证模型的完整性和一致性;模型推理则负责根据模型生成相应的软件产品,并对产品进行验证和测试。可变模型也是软件产品线可变性建模技术中的重要组成部分,它通过对模型进行变异和组合,生成具有不同功能或特征的软件产品。
在模型管理方面,常用的技术包括版本控制、基线管理、模型合并与冲突解决等。版本控制可以实现对模型进行标记、注释和修订,保证模型的完整性和可追溯性;基线管理则可以将模型划分为不同的基线,方便对模型进行分类和版本控制;模型合并与冲突解决则可以避免不同模型之间的相互干扰和冲突。
在模型推理方面,常用的技术包括代码生成、代码变异和测试技术等。代码生成可以根据模型自动生成相应的代码,提高开发效率;代码变异则可以实现在已有代码的基础上进行变异,生成新的代码或软件产品;测试技术则可以对生成的代码或软件产品进行验证和测试,保证其正确性和稳定性。
在可变模型方面,常用的技术包括参数化模型、配置模型和可变模型管理等。参数化模型可以通过定义模型的参数和变量,实现对模型的灵活控制和调整;配置模型则可以将模型的不同部分进行配置和组合,生成不同的软件产品;可变模型管理则可以实现对可变模型的创建、维护和版本控制,保证可变模型的完整性和一致性。
软件产品线可变性建模技术是一个系统性的方法和技术,各个组成部分之间相互、相互依赖。模型管理是整个系统的核心,它负责建立、维护和版本控制模型,保证模型的完整性和一致性;模型推理则根据模型生成相应的软件产品,并对产品进行验证和测试,保证产品的正确性和稳定性;可变模型则通过对模型进行变异和组合,生成具有不同功能或特征的软件产品,实现对软件产品线的扩展和优化。
本文对软件产品线可变性建模技术进行了系统性的综述,介绍了该技术的各个方面,包括基本概念、原理、方法、技术,以及各个技术的优缺点和适用范围等。通过对该技术进行系统性地综述和分析,发现该领域还存在一些不足之处和需要进一步探讨的问题,例如如何提高模型的精度和效率、如何解决模型推理中的冲突和变异等问题。希望本文的内容可以为相关领域的研究和实践提供一定的参考和借鉴。
随着能源互联网的快速发展,电网信息物理系统(Cyber-PhysicalSystems,CPS)已成为智能电网领域的研究热点。CPS是一种将物理世界与信息世界紧密融合的混合系统,其核心是将计算、通信、控制等技术有机地融合到系统中,实现系统的智能化、自适应和鲁棒性。为了有效分析和设计CPS,建立准确的混合系统模型至关重要。
混合系统建模方法是一种跨学科的方法,它结合了连续数学建模和离散事件建模的优点。连续数学建模常用于描述物理过程和稳态行为,而离散事件建模则更适合描述系统中的动态行为和开关状态。在混合系统建模中,需要将两种建模方法结合起来,以全面刻画CPS的复杂行为。
针对电网信息物理系统的特点和发展趋势,本文提出了一种
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2024年人工智能算法授权合同模板集合3篇
- 2024员工待岗期间工作交接及保密协议3篇
- 2024年矿山开采挖机作业外包合同2篇
- 2024年度碳排放权交易合同:某企业与环境交易所关于碳排放权交易合同2篇
- 2024年新型LED灯珠研发与应用合作协议3篇
- 2024年度预科生入学合同协议书3篇
- 2024事业单位聘用合同试用期管理及考核办法3篇
- 2024年新型瓷砖研发合作生产销售合同模板3篇
- 2024年度交通枢纽保安人员劳务及应急处置合同3篇
- 2024年校运动队赛事赞助商协议版B版
- GB/T 1962.2-2001注射器、注射针及其他医疗器械6%(鲁尔)圆锥接头第2部分:锁定接头
- GB/T 17646-2013小型风力发电机组设计要求
- 中医拔罐技术试题及答案
- 2023年苏教版小学数学全套教材内容安排表
- 灭火器验收表
- 装修工程竣工验收报告(7篇)
- 商务沟通-课件
- ommaya囊的护理教学课件
- 俄罗斯教育课件
- 国家开放大学《传感器与测试技术》实验参考答案
- 第二单元写作《学写传记》课件-部编版语文八年级上册
评论
0/150
提交评论